Online b-jets tagging at CDF
We propose a method to identify b-quark jets at trigger level which exploits recently increased CDF trigger system capabilities. b-quark jets identification is of central interest for the CDF high-PT physics program, and the possibility to select online b-jets enriched samples can extend the physics reaches especially for light Higgs boson searches where the Hrarrbb macr decay mode is dominant. Exploiting new trigger primitives provided by two recent trigger upgrades, the Level2 XFT stereo tracking and the improved Level2 cluster-finder, in conjunction with the existing Silicon Vertex Tracker (SVT), we design an online trigger algorithm aimed at selecting good purity b-jets samples useful for many physics measurements, the most important being inclusive Hrarr bb macr searches. We discuss the performances of the proposed b-tagging algorithm which must guarantee reasonable trigger rates at luminosity greater than 2times1032 cm-2 s-1 and provide high efficiency on Hrarrbb macr events.
